/Linux-v4.19/drivers/media/platform/s5p-jpeg/ |
D | jpeg-core.c | 618 switch (ctx->jpeg->variant->version) { in s5p_jpeg_to_user_subsampling() 795 struct s5p_jpeg *jpeg = ctx->jpeg; in exynos4_jpeg_parse_decode_h_tbl() local 824 exynos4_jpeg_select_dec_h_tbl(jpeg->regs, c, in exynos4_jpeg_parse_decode_h_tbl() 832 struct s5p_jpeg *jpeg = ctx->jpeg; in exynos4_jpeg_parse_huff_tbl() local 860 writel(word, jpeg->regs + in exynos4_jpeg_parse_huff_tbl() 874 writel(word, jpeg->regs + in exynos4_jpeg_parse_huff_tbl() 881 writel(word, jpeg->regs + in exynos4_jpeg_parse_huff_tbl() 891 struct s5p_jpeg *jpeg = ctx->jpeg; in exynos4_jpeg_parse_decode_q_tbl() local 906 exynos4_jpeg_set_dec_components(jpeg->regs, components); in exynos4_jpeg_parse_decode_q_tbl() 916 exynos4_jpeg_select_dec_q_tbl(jpeg->regs, c, x); in exynos4_jpeg_parse_decode_q_tbl() [all …]
|
D | Makefile | 1 s5p-jpeg-objs := jpeg-core.o jpeg-hw-exynos3250.o jpeg-hw-exynos4.o jpeg-hw-s5p.o 2 obj-$(CONFIG_VIDEO_SAMSUNG_S5P_JPEG) += s5p-jpeg.o
|
D | jpeg-core.h | 232 struct s5p_jpeg *jpeg; member
|
/Linux-v4.19/drivers/media/platform/mtk-jpeg/ |
D | mtk_jpeg_core.c | 95 struct mtk_jpeg_dev *jpeg = video_drvdata(file); in mtk_jpeg_querycap() local 100 dev_name(jpeg->dev)); in mtk_jpeg_querycap() 212 struct mtk_jpeg_dev *jpeg = ctx->jpeg; in mtk_jpeg_try_fmt_mplane() local 259 v4l2_dbg(2, debug, &jpeg->v4l2_dev, "wxh:%ux%u\n", in mtk_jpeg_try_fmt_mplane() 262 v4l2_dbg(2, debug, &jpeg->v4l2_dev, in mtk_jpeg_try_fmt_mplane() 278 struct mtk_jpeg_dev *jpeg = ctx->jpeg; in mtk_jpeg_g_fmt_vid_mplane() local 298 v4l2_dbg(1, debug, &jpeg->v4l2_dev, "(%d) g_fmt:%c%c%c%c wxh:%ux%u\n", in mtk_jpeg_g_fmt_vid_mplane() 313 v4l2_dbg(1, debug, &jpeg->v4l2_dev, in mtk_jpeg_g_fmt_vid_mplane() 333 v4l2_dbg(2, debug, &ctx->jpeg->v4l2_dev, "(%d) try_fmt:%c%c%c%c\n", in mtk_jpeg_try_fmt_vid_cap_mplane() 354 v4l2_dbg(2, debug, &ctx->jpeg->v4l2_dev, "(%d) try_fmt:%c%c%c%c\n", in mtk_jpeg_try_fmt_vid_out_mplane() [all …]
|
D | mtk_jpeg_core.h | 127 struct mtk_jpeg_dev *jpeg; member
|
/Linux-v4.19/Documentation/devicetree/bindings/media/ |
D | exynos-jpeg-codec.txt | 6 "samsung,s5pv210-jpeg", "samsung,exynos4210-jpeg", 7 "samsung,exynos3250-jpeg", "samsung,exynos5420-jpeg", 8 "samsung,exynos5433-jpeg"; 12 - "jpeg" for the core gate clock,
|
D | renesas,jpu.txt | 20 jpeg-codec@fe980000 {
|
D | mediatek-jpeg-decoder.txt | 9 - reg : physical base address of the jpeg decoder registers and length of
|
/Linux-v4.19/Documentation/media/uapi/v4l/ |
D | vidioc-g-jpegcomp.rst | 39 :ref:`JPEG class controls <jpeg-controls>` for image quality and JPEG 70 :ref:`V4L2_CID_JPEG_COMPRESSION_QUALITY <jpeg-quality-control>` 90 - See :ref:`jpeg-markers`. Deprecated. If 91 :ref:`V4L2_CID_JPEG_ACTIVE_MARKER <jpeg-active-marker-control>`
|
D | colorspaces-defs.rst | 67 - See :ref:`col-jpeg`.
|
D | biblio.rst | 139 .. _w3c-jpeg-jfif:
|
D | v4l2.rst | 194 Added :ref:`JPEG compression control class. <jpeg-controls>`
|
/Linux-v4.19/drivers/media/platform/ |
D | Makefile | 38 obj-$(CONFIG_VIDEO_SAMSUNG_S5P_JPEG) += s5p-jpeg/ 90 obj-$(CONFIG_VIDEO_MEDIATEK_JPEG) += mtk-jpeg/
|
D | Kconfig | 192 Mediatek jpeg codec driver provides HW capability to decode 196 module will be called mtk-jpeg
|
/Linux-v4.19/drivers/media/platform/coda/ |
D | Makefile | 3 coda-objs := coda-common.o coda-bit.o coda-gdi.o coda-h264.o coda-jpeg.o
|
/Linux-v4.19/Documentation/media/v4l-drivers/ |
D | meye.rst | 122 Takes a snapshot in an uncompressed or compressed jpeg format. 124 jpeg snapshot) the size of the image. The image data is
|
/Linux-v4.19/Documentation/devicetree/bindings/display/hisilicon/ |
D | hisi-ade.txt | 18 jpeg codec.
|
/Linux-v4.19/Documentation/media/ |
D | videodev2.h.rst.exceptions | 186 replace define V4L2_JPEG_MARKER_DHT jpeg-markers 187 replace define V4L2_JPEG_MARKER_DQT jpeg-markers 188 replace define V4L2_JPEG_MARKER_DRI jpeg-markers 189 replace define V4L2_JPEG_MARKER_COM jpeg-markers 190 replace define V4L2_JPEG_MARKER_APP jpeg-markers
|
/Linux-v4.19/Documentation/ |
D | dontdiff | 24 *.jpeg
|
/Linux-v4.19/arch/arm/boot/dts/ |
D | exynos5420.dtsi | 706 jpeg_0: jpeg@11f50000 { 707 compatible = "samsung,exynos5420-jpeg"; 710 clock-names = "jpeg"; 715 jpeg_1: jpeg@11f60000 { 716 compatible = "samsung,exynos5420-jpeg"; 719 clock-names = "jpeg";
|
D | exynos3250.dtsi | 293 jpeg: codec@11830000 { label 294 compatible = "samsung,exynos3250-jpeg"; 298 clock-names = "jpeg", "sclk";
|
D | exynos4.dtsi | 741 jpeg_codec: jpeg-codec@11840000 { 742 compatible = "samsung,exynos4210-jpeg"; 746 clock-names = "jpeg";
|
D | atlas7.dtsi | 1493 jpeg@17000000 { 1494 compatible = "sirf,atlas7-jpeg";
|
D | exynos4412.dtsi | 722 compatible = "samsung,exynos4212-jpeg";
|
/Linux-v4.19/drivers/media/platform/exynos4-is/ |
D | fimc-capture.c | 1013 bool jpeg = fimc_fmt_is_user_defined(color); in fimc_capture_mark_jpeg_xfer() local 1015 ctx->scaler.enabled = !jpeg; in fimc_capture_mark_jpeg_xfer() 1016 fimc_ctrls_activate(ctx, !jpeg); in fimc_capture_mark_jpeg_xfer() 1018 if (jpeg) in fimc_capture_mark_jpeg_xfer()
|